Output 8132578efd7eb02201c603d65e712eefca4d7d401cb56d87af251beff9c671b7:0

value
28107016
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 084347c30b948adf1dd3a475403ef20123db71c7 OP_EQUALVERIFY OP_CHECKSIG
address
1kh1Fgqy3CXN93PHGRP2b6QgHT6LJw7oW
transaction
8132578efd7eb02201c603d65e712eefca4d7d401cb56d87af251beff9c671b7
spent
true